Abstract: Topological phases of matter are exotic states of matter with anyonic excitations such as the fractional quantum Hall (FQH) liquids. FQH liquids are described effectively by Witten's Chern-Simons theories. More general topological phases of matter are described by unitary TQFTs or unitary braided tensor categories. I will explain what are topological phases of matter, the mathematical models for topological phases of matter, their emergence from electrons and classification. If time permits, the application to quantum computing.
